Linking to your article on your user page[edit]

You might want to organize your user page by adding a new section entitled, "Pages I'm editing" and then putting the internal link to the Wikipedia page in that section. To do so, go to your user page, click the "New Section" tab at the top right of the page. In the body of the section, click the icon to insert a link and just type the name of the page you're working on. After a second or two, you should see a message that says "Page Exists" which means that it found the Wikipedia page and will create an internal link to it.
